I picked up one that had been altered (sight removed, drilled and tapped new bolt handle, Got scope mounted and finally got to shoot it Saturday, tried federal auto match, and champion bulk . bolt lift and close rough so wanted to cycle it some and it is smoothing some heavy trigger about 8lb. got it sighted in at 25 yd, moved back to 50 , unscrewed front swivel to remove barrel tension, groups got smaller auto match most accurate and reliable couple of groups 3/8!, torqued guard screws a little ,target shot up so pulled off to side shot a round for aiming point next shot through same hole! pack and go to recliner with magnum grin on face. Always heard they will shoot and have one that's original I haven't shot so now I know.
